fail_fast: true repos: - repo: local hooks: - id: black name: Black entry: poetry run black docling examples tests pass_filenames: false language: system files: '\.py$' - id: isort name: isort entry: poetry run isort docling examples tests pass_filenames: false language: system files: '\.py$' # - id: flake8 # name: flake8 # entry: poetry run flake8 docling # pass_filenames: false # language: system # files: '\.py$' # - id: mypy # name: MyPy # entry: poetry run mypy docling # pass_filenames: false # language: system # files: '\.py$' - id: nbqa_black name: nbQA Black entry: poetry run nbqa black examples pass_filenames: false language: system files: '\.ipynb$' - id: nbqa_isort name: nbQA isort entry: poetry run nbqa isort examples pass_filenames: false language: system files: '\.ipynb$' - id: poetry name: Poetry check entry: poetry check --lock pass_filenames: false language: system